About the role
We’re always excited to welcome new Great Mates to our rapidly growing team. We currently have multiple great opportunities for experienced and dedicated Community Nurse (Registered Nurse). This is an exciting and rewarding role where you’ll be working a 7-day week roster across several locations in the Gold Coast region as per the needs of the people we support. You’ll be responsible for bringing care and support to our participants through dedicated clinical nursing services, as well as supporting the internal Great Mates team as a key member. If you’re someone who is always up for a challenge and thrives working with people, both individually and as part of a team, this is for you.
About The Position:
Participate in providing comprehensive and direct nursing care
Provide individualised case management to specific group of clients in a specific area of nursing practice
Address and respond to changes in client conditions
Collaborate with other health professionals such as General Practitioners (GP) and Allied Health to ensure appropriate actions are taken based on client needs
Work with other healthcare professionals to ensure client needs are understood and planned for
Assist with client care tasks such as care planning and reviewing information used by lifestyle assistants
Encourage the use of technology to improve client services and outcomes
Provide chronic disease and health education/coaching to clients and their families, considering cultural, spiritual, intellectual/educational, and psychosocial differences
Ensure documentation meets quality and compliance standards
About You:
A minimum of 2 years of experience and a current AHPRA registration
Strong knowledge and experience in managing chronic diseases
Demonstrated ability to use professional judgement and gather information during decision-making processes
Familiarity with community nursing services and willingness to learn new technologies
Strong communication and administration skills
Current Open Drivers License (with no restrictions).
NDIS Worker Screen Check
Working With Children's Check
First Aid & CPR (or willing to obtain)
Provide evidence of immunisation history
Covid 19 vaccination with booster
